Supreme Court dismisses gangster Abu Salem’s plea claiming completion of 25-year prison term

India’s Supreme Court rejected a petition by former underworld figure Abu Salem, who argued that his sentence should end after serving 25 years. Salem, extradited from Portugal in 2005 for his role in the 1993 Mumbai bombings, claimed the government had assured he would not be held longer. The court found no basis to terminate his imprisonment.
